对子目录使用Include *pug是一种在Pug模板引擎中引入子目录的方法。Pug是一种高性能的模板引擎,它可以简化HTML代码的编写。
当我们在Pug模板中使用Include *pug时,它会将指定目录下的所有以.pug为后缀的文件都包含进来。这样可以方便地组织和管理模板文件,提高代码的可维护性和重用性。
Include *pug的优势包括:
- 模块化:通过将相关的模板文件组织在子目录中,可以实现模块化开发,提高代码的可读性和可维护性。
- 代码重用:可以在不同的模板文件中引用同一个子目录下的模板文件,实现代码的重用,避免重复编写相似的代码。
- 简化文件路径:使用Include *pug可以简化文件路径的书写,只需要指定子目录的路径即可,无需写出每个具体的文件路径。
Include *pug的应用场景包括:
- 网站开发:在构建网站时,可以将不同页面的公共部分(如导航栏、页脚等)放在子目录中,通过Include *pug引入,提高开发效率。
- 前端组件库:在开发前端组件库时,可以将不同组件的模板文件放在子目录中,通过Include *pug引入,方便组件的复用和维护。
- 多语言支持:如果需要支持多语言,可以将不同语言版本的模板文件放在子目录中,通过Include *pug引入对应的语言版本,实现多语言切换。
腾讯云提供的相关产品和产品介绍链接地址如下:
- 云服务器(CVM):https://cloud.tencent.com/product/cvm
- 云数据库 MySQL 版(CDB):https://cloud.tencent.com/product/cdb
- 云原生应用引擎(TKE):https://cloud.tencent.com/product/tke
- 云存储(COS):https://cloud.tencent.com/product/cos
- 人工智能(AI):https://cloud.tencent.com/product/ai
- 物联网(IoT):https://cloud.tencent.com/product/iotexplorer
- 移动开发(移动推送、移动分析):https://cloud.tencent.com/product/mps
请注意,以上链接仅供参考,具体产品选择应根据实际需求和情况进行评估和决策。